What is Agile methodology in simple words?

The Agile methodology is a way to manage a project by breaking it up into several phases. It involves constant collaboration with stakeholders and continuous improvement at every stage. Once the work begins, teams cycle through a process of planning, executing, and evaluating.

What is agile methodology and how it works?

How does an agile process work? Agile divides a project into smaller parts, called ‘user stories’. This means agile projects create something simple that they can then iterate on based on users’ feedback, making the software better suited to users’ needs while minimising complexity.

Why Agile is used?

With Agile software development, teams can quickly adapt to requirements changes without negatively impacting release dates. Not only that, Agile helps reduce technical debt, improve customer satisfaction and deliver a higher quality product.

What is difference between agile and waterfall?

Agile and waterfall are two distinctive methodologies of processes to complete projects or work items. Agile is an iterative methodology that incorporates a cyclic and collaborative process. Waterfall is a sequential methodology that can also be collaborative, but tasks are generally handled in a more linear process.

What is Agile life cycle?

The Agile software development life cycle is the structured series of stages that a product goes through as it moves from beginning to end. It contains six phases: concept, inception, iteration, release, maintenance, and retirement.

Is Scrum agile or Waterfall?

Scrum is a subset of Agile and one of the most popular process frameworks for implementing Agile. It is an iterative software development model used to manage complex software and product development.

Is agile a framework or methodology?

The publication of the Agile Manifesto in 2001 marks the birth of agile as a methodology. Since then, many agile frameworks have emerged such as scrum, kanban, lean, and Extreme Programming (XP). Each embodies the core principles of frequent iteration, continuous learning, and high quality in its own way.
